Atem is a Ancient Egyptian Pharaoh, who sealed a part of his soul within the Millennium Puzzle. This part of his soul took on the entity Yami Yugi, which resided in the body of Yugi Muto, after Yugi solved the Millennium Puzzle.

Character biography

Anime and Manga

As son of king Aknamkanon, Atem became heir to the throne and the Millennium Puzzle. Three thousand years before the current storyline, he defeated Zorc Necrophades, sealing his shadow magic, along with himself, inside the Millennium Items. Atem's reincarnation is Yugi Muto.

Atem, now a disembodied, amnesiac spirit, aided Yugi many times over the course of his adventures, in a form known only as "Yami Yugi." Yugi attempts to return the favor by finding the secret of Atem's past. Yugi and his friends find themselves sucked into a Dark RPG played by Yami Yugi and his counterpart in the Millennium Ring, they meet the living Atem, who is played by his spiritual self as a character in the RPG.

With the aid of Yugi's friends, as well as the Sacred Guardians, Atem's priests who are also characters in the game, the Pharaoh re-enacts his own life in the RPG. After Yugi defeats a manifestation of Bakura, Yami learns his own name, enabling Atem, in the game, to summon The Creator God of Light, Horakhty, to defeat Zorc before Bakura can summon him to the present.

After the ceremonial duel, Yami crosses to the afterlife and becomes Atem once again, free to join his friends in the next world.

Atem in Yu-Gi-Oh! Forbidden Memories

The Prince

In Yu-Gi-Oh! Forbidden Memories, Atem appears as the prince of the Amenhotep Dynasty in Ancient Egypt. His name is chosen by the player. Atem often sneaks out of the palace to spend time at the Dueling Gronds, with the villagers particularly Teana and Jono, who are unaware of his royalty.

After returning to the palace one night, he finds the mage Heishin, now in possession of the Millennium Rod has attacked the palace and demands the Millennium Puzzle. Atem's attendent Simon Muran gives Atem to the Puzzle and tells him to run. He as unable to escape as he is confronted by Heishin. Heishin demands the Puzzle. Atem duels him to escape. Heishin would win the duel. If the player wins, Heishin would call it a waisted effort and continue to duel until the player loses. After losing Simon convinces Atem to shatter the Puzzle.

After shattering the puzzle Simon seals Atem inside it, where he remains for a Millennia, until Yugi Muto enters a competion hosted by Seto Kaiba. Here Shadi, holder of the Millennium Key and Scale says that he's here because of Yugi's Millennium Item. He uses the Key to open Yugi's mind, where he can meet Atem. Here Atem gives Yugi six cards. Although Atem doesn't speak Yugi understands what Atem wants of him. Yugi defeats all the present day holders of the Millennium Items in the tornament, each time sealing their Item in one of the cards. Using the six cards Yugi is able to send Atem home.

When Atem arrives home the Mages have taken over the dynasty. He heads to the King's Valley in search of the Forbidden Ruins. Here he meets a man, who recognizes him as Prince, but does not know the location of the Forbidden Ruins. So Atem returns to the Pharaoh's Palace, which is now in ruins. After confrontin and defeating a Mage Soldier here Atem finds a map to the Forbidden Ruins. Atem returns to the King's Valley, where the man now escorts him to the ruins. Here he finds a map to the locations of the Millennium Items. Seto meets him at the ruins. He informs Atem the map shows the location of where Heishin has hidden the Items and that he plans to betray Heishin.

The Prince proceeds to defeat the High Mages and aquire all Millennium Items bar the Rod, which is held by Seto. After this Atem meets Jono, who tells him that the Mages have kidnapped Teana. Jono leads him to Heishin place, after passing through the Labyrinth Mage(s), the boys find her held hostage by Seto who hands her back, saying he used her to guide Atem to Heishin's chambers. He encourages Atem to proceed and defeat Heishin. The prince proceeds and defeats the Guardians Sebek and Neku before finding and defeating Heishin.

After Heishin's defeat, Seto confronts Atem and explains that he used him to gather all the Items. He tells Atem about the power of the Items, that they can be used to summon great power. As Seto is about to claim the power Heishin appears and holds a knife to Seto's neck and demands the Items. Atem hands them over and Heishin uses them to Summon DarkNite. DarkNite refuses to obey Heishin and turns him into a card, which he burns. Atem uses the Millennium Item Cards, to hold back DarkNite and force him to a duel to send him back where he came from. After Atem wins, DarkNite turns into NiteMare and demands a final duel. The Prince plays on and defeats NiteMare.

Afterwards Atem rules on as King.
